cancel
Showing results for 
Search instead for 
Did you mean: 
cancel
3442
Views
4
Helpful
1
Replies

NAT extendable and no-alias option...

teyobanilom
Level 1
Level 1

Can somebody help me out please.

What does the extendable and no-alias option on "ip nat inside source static" used for?

Thanks.

1 Reply 1

jolmo
Level 4
Level 4

- The extendable keyword allows the user to configure several ambiguous static translations, where an ambiguous translations are translations with the same local or global address.

The software does not allow two static translations with the same local address, though, because it is ambiguous from the inside. The router will accept these static translations and resolve the ambiguity by creating full translations (all addresses and ports) if the static translations are marked as "extendable".

- Regarding "no-alias": Many customers want to configure the NAT software to translate their local addresses to global addresses allocated from unused addresses from an attached subnet. This requires that the router answer ARP requests for those addresses so that packets destined for the global addresses are accepted by the router and translated. (Routing takes care of this packet delivery when the global addresses are allocated from a virtual network which isn't connected to anything.) When a NAT pool used as an inside global or outside local pool consists of addresses on an attached subnet, the software will generate an alias for that address so that the router will answer ARPs for those addresses.

This automatic aliasing also occurs for inside global or outside local addresses in static entries. It can be disabled for static entries by using the "no-alias" keyword

Hope this helps

Review Cisco Networking for a $25 gift card